牛津词典

    verb

    • 猛拉;猛拽
      to pull sth/sb hard, quickly and suddenly
      1. He yanked her to her feet.
        他一下子把她拉起来。
      2. I yanked the door open.
        我猛地把门拽开。
      3. Liz yanked at my arm.
        利兹猛地拉了一下我的胳膊。

    柯林斯词典

    • VERB 猛拉;猛拽
      If youyanksomeone or something somewhere, you pull them there suddenly and with a lot of force.
      1. She yanked open the drawer...
        她猛地拉开了抽屉。
      2. She yanked the child back into the house...
        她使劲儿把那个孩子拽回了房子里。
      3. He yanked a handkerchief out of his pocket...
        他从口袋里拽出一条手帕。
      4. A quick-thinking ticket inspector yanked an emergency cord.
        一个反应迅速的查票员猛地拉下了紧急刹车索。
      5. Yankis also a noun.
      6. Grabbing his ponytail, Shirley gave it a yank.
        雪莉抓住他的马尾辫,猛地一拽。
